I also run my own home server that I play on locally. One computer runs the server and the client at the same time - graphics are "best" on the client as well with smooth lighting, far render distance, fancy graphics etc - because it's a pretty good computer. I'm going to call this computer "serv-PC" in this post. Another one, not nearly as good, just runs the client and connects: this one will be called "other-PC."
Now, when playing the game, other-PC has ok FPS when playing on low graphics settings. This is just the computer being crappy. It updates the map instantly, and there is absolutely NO Mysterious lag. On the other hand, serv-PC, running with some awesome graphics at 60FPS or so, takes at least one minute to chat, break/place blocks etc. It's wierd, though, because other-PC is changing blocks, sending the info through the network to serv-PC, and getting it back all updated, while the serv-PC is having issues sending data to itself. I have no lag on Single Player on serv-PC. I guarantee that it is not because serv-PC is not good enough!
The kicker is that when I had Beta 1.2, it was fine. So yes, Beta 1.3 is annoying! (I'm going to test it on 1.4 now though, but I'm not feeling optimistic)
